refactor(db): unwind vestigial worker source plumbing (ADR-0052 follow-up)

ADR-0052 moved success journaling out of the worker to the dispatch
layer, leaving the `source` that handlers threaded purely for the
worker's old history.log write dead. Remove it:

- drop `_source` from finalize_persistence and do_rebuild_from_text
- inline + delete the three read-only *_request wrappers
- drop the now-unused `source` param from the ~30 forwarding worker
  handlers (leaf + composite), compiler-guided
- remove the `source` field from the DescribeTable/QueryData/RunSelect
  requests and their DatabaseHandle methods (call sites updated)

The only worker `source` left is the snapshot/undo label
(snapshot_then / stage_pre_mutation / begin_batch). Purely mechanical,
no behaviour change. 2471 pass / 0 fail / 1 ignored, clippy clean.
